The Navy Band Southwest is touring the Bay Area in August. As part of their community outreach initiatives, they will perform a concert and conduct a masterclass, featuring GSYO Symphony woodwind and brass musicians! This is a great opportunity to hear a performance by one of the top brass bands in the country. Admission is free. No ticket required. Seating is first come, first served. Navy Band Southwest is one of the Navy’s finest and oldest continuing musical organizations. With over 80 years of support to the San Diego community, the band serves as the musical ambassador for the Commander, Navy Region Southwest. Under the direction of Lieutenant Commander Bruce J. Mansfield, the band is located onboard Naval Base San Diego and serves the military and civilian communities throughout the Southwestern United States.
